A Car Salesperson acts as the liaison between the dealership and the customer during the transaction process of buying a new or used vehicle. These dealerships can sell new vehicles, used vehicles or both. A good salesperson that writes good numbers can advance to the Sales Manager position.
What is the work of sales associate?
A Sales Associate, or Retail Sales Associate, is responsible for assisting customers throughout the buying process. Their duties include greeting customers when they enter the store, helping customers find specific products or showing them how to use them and ringing up customer purchases on the POS register.

How much do car sales employees make?
According to payscale.com, the average wage for a car sales person is $48,000, but they can also earn an average of $3000 a year in bonuses on top of that, plus an average of $19,888 in commissions. It goes on to say that salary can range from $38K to $55K while commissions can range from $10k to $54K.

What are the duties of a retail sales associate?
A retail sales associate must be able to effectively communicate with the customers the product details, and comfortably greet them and make small talk. Sales associates who are good at their jobs are easily able to identify exactly what the customers are looking for by paying close attention to what they are saying.
Do you need a high school diploma to become a sales associate?
Sales associates may or may not require a minimum of a high school diploma. Some employers may prefer candidates with a certain degree of education in an area related to the merchandize sold by the store.
